In a letter sent to Kentucky Gov. Matt Bevin on Oct. 26, Judge W. Mitchell Nance advised him that he would officially leave his post starting Dec. 16. His decision came after the state's American Civil Liberties Union, Lambda Legal, University of Louisville professor Sam Marcosson, and the Kentucky Fairness Campaign filed a complaint about the judge's recusal from same-sex adoption cases in April, Christian News detailed.
